Transaction e35faa436caa39e871f239927abadd3bdf28a3312faa61c1d574b0194e1871c3
1 Input
1 Output
-
e35faa436caa39e871f239927abadd3bdf28a3312faa61c1d574b0194e1871c3:0
- value
- 6866263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37423d4b946262ddd41bebc10a5b0791ab39c OP_EQUAL
- address
- 3BMEX9HMJyoxvVeBSf2h2T2LyudruwtNwH